The Rabaul Caldera
The Rabaul caldera is an incredible geological formation created by volcanic eruptions and the collapse of a massive volcano. This rugged landscape is dotted with steaming vents, lush rainforests, and stunning viewpoints that reveal the magnificence of the surrounding area.
- What to Expect:
- Breathtaking views of Tavurvur and its surrounding scenery.
- Unique volcanic features such as hot springs and fumaroles.
- Opportunities to spot native wildlife among the lush vegetation.
Hiking Mount Tavurvur
Hiking the Tavurvur volcano is a must for any adventure enthusiast. The trek leads you through vibrant jungle trails and offers panoramic views of the caldera. As you ascend, you can witness the power of nature and the geological forces that shaped this extraordinary landscape.
Key Highlights:
- Difficulty Level: Moderate to challenging, suitable for those with a decent level of fitness.
- Guided Tours: Local guides are available to enhance your experience with their knowledge of the area.
- Best Time to Visit: The dry season (April to October) is ideal for hiking, as the trails are less muddy and the weather is more predictable.
WWII History and Sunken Shipwrecks
The history of Rabaul is deeply entrenched in World War II, and a visit wouldn't be complete without exploring the submerged wrecks that lay off the coast. These remnants serve as a haunting reminder of the past and offer excellent snorkeling opportunities.
Explore the Shipwrecks:
- Submerged Japanese Ships: Discover the remains of ships that once sailed these waters, now lying peacefully beneath the waves.
- Snorkeling Adventures: Get up close and personal with marine life in these historical sites, making for an unforgettable experience.
